Output 6635eb99c6dcd807372904f40603e69928970b32c935ffb495c950ae093655f2:16

value
1741091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ac1cfb09c8af2bb1bf725764e7db7597fd87382 OP_EQUAL
address
35b6Uqxyxf6YrMiMNAQDB4BxaVNipo2UwZ
transaction
6635eb99c6dcd807372904f40603e69928970b32c935ffb495c950ae093655f2
confirmations
208305
spent
true